Part of Speech
Sentence Patterns
 Course 3 > Grammar > Tense > Tense > Tenses with Modals          │TextExercises

  1. 情态动词+动词原形,表示能力、允许、必须、可能、劝告、意愿、建议等,如:
    Tom couldn't walk last month but now he can.
    You must be back before dark.

    You may go now. (表示许可)
    It may rain tomorrow. (表示可能)

  2. 情态动词 + be + V-ing,表示推测某动作现在是否正在进行,如:
    She may be reading the novel.
    He can't be working now.

  3. 情态动词 + have + 过去分词
   a. may/might + have + 过去分词,表示推测过去某动作“也许”发生了,如:
    He may/might have heard the news yesterday.

   b. could + have + 过去分词,表示推测过去某动作“很可能发生了”,如:
    — The dictionary has disappeared. Who could have taken it?
    — Tom could have taken it; he was there alone yesterday.

   c. must + have +过去分词,表示推测过去某动作“一定”发生了,如:
     He must have gone home.

   d. can't/couldn't + have + 过去分词,表示推测过去某动作“一定没发生”,如:
     He couldn't have gone there.

   e. should/ought to + have + 过去分词,表示“本来应该做而实际未做”的事,如:
     You should have reviewed your lessons.

   f. needn't + have + 过去分词,表示不必做但已做了的事,如:
     You needn't have brought wine. We've got plenty.











©Experiencing English 2002